Transaction 21db7a5698a890273cae2912abd55179e2c278486db749c21dd21d162187127b

2 Input
2 Outputs
  • 21db7a5698a890273cae2912abd55179e2c278486db749c21dd21d162187127b:0
  • value  10000000
    address  1FPBdifTT5bZbpRQ4TXThu496Mi1uXCNpz
  • 21db7a5698a890273cae2912abd55179e2c278486db749c21dd21d162187127b:1
  • value  3399063
    address  3GnkJZWfBWJmU6AgEosh3MGxEQSsb1ky2d